Lucknow: Samajwadi Party’s (SP) leaders are on the footmarks of senior Azam Khan. As Azam decided not to meet the party’s delegation similarly others too. Even the MLAs Shazil Islam didn’t take part in the Iftar Party organized by the district unit of SP.

After the polls, Akhilesh Yadav is dealing with the allegations that he is not paying attention to Muslims. Though the community united before him during the UP Polls, Akhilesh is not becoming their voice. Azam was annoyed over this and his message was well circulated throughout the state. Other muslim leaders of the party too started chorusing their voices with Azam. Unhappy Azam refused to meet the SP delegation, which was sent by Akhilesh Yadav to Sitapur jail, where Azam is lodged. Though he met warm-hearted with PSP-L chief Shivpal Yadav and congress’s Acharya Pramod Krishnam.

Having his foots in the same shoes, Shazil Islam too didn’t meet the SP delegation in Bareilly. The 12-member SP delegation led by MLC Sanjay Lathar reached Bareilly on Tuesday and waited for Shazil at his petrol pump, which was recently demolished by Bareilly Development Authority. After that, the delegation reached Islam’s residence, the house was locked from the outside. The delegation had to return without meeting Shazil. On Wednesday Shazil didn’t take part in the Iftar Party too.

In political circles, these two incidents are the talking point. Incidents are observed as the Muslim leaders are differing their paths to Samajwadi Party as he was silent when they were treated tough by the government. The sources close to Shazil, say that he wanted to remain away from the party to avoid any other action against him. Last time too he tried to make the image of Akhilesh as a fighter for the community and he was assuring them that they shouldn’t be worried. Then the action was taken against him. An FIR was lodged and even his petrol pump was razed.
